How many lawsuits have been filed against TikTok?
The settlement stems from 21 separate lawsuits accusing TikTok of violating federal and state law by collecting and using the personal data of users without “sufficient notice and consent.”
Can Illinois residents sue companies for violating biometrics?
Users who live in Il linois may be entitled to six times as much money as non-Illinois residents because the state is the only one in the nation that “allows people to sue companies for violating biometric privacy laws.”

How much do you get for a TikTok claim?
If 1.5% of TikTok users submit a claim, most people could receive $63.89 while people in Illinois could receive $383.33 due to a law that allows larger settlements there. If 20% of eligible people submit claims, non-Illinois residents could get $4.70; Illinois residents could get $28.75.
How many people are affected by the TikTok lawsuit?
The settlement, pending from a lawsuit filed in the U.S. District Court of the Northern District of Illinois, could affect as many as 89 million people. The lawsuit alleges Byte parent company TikTok improperly collected and used plaintiff’s data, claims the company denies.

How Much Are the Big Influencers Making on TikTok?
Forbes released its first-ever list of TikTok's highest-paid stars in 2020. According to that, Addison Rae Easterling tops the list. She made a whopping $5 million in a year. Charli D' Amelio is a close second, having made $4 million in 2020, whereas her sister Dixie D' Amelio occupies third place on the list—having made $2.9 million.
